🧡 Fun Fact About Pitbull Dog Names
Did you know that Pitbulls are among the most misjudged yet affectionate dog breeds? Despite their tough appearance, they are often called “nanny dogs” due to their gentle nature with families. Because of this dual personality, their names often reflect both strength and sweetness. Names like Titan highlight power, while names like Buddy showcase their loving nature.
Another fun fact: dogs respond best to names with one or two syllables, especially those ending in vowels. This makes training easier and improves communication. So while choosing a name, balance creativity with practicality—it’s not just a label, it’s a lifelong identity.
🎯 How to Choose the Perfect Name for Your Pitbull Dog
Choosing the right name for your Pitbull is more than just picking something that sounds cool. It should match your dog’s personality, appearance, and energy level. For example, a muscular and confident dog might suit a name like Diesel, while a playful and goofy pup could be Bubbles.
Keep these tips in mind:
- Keep it short and simple for easy recall
- Avoid names that sound like commands (e.g., “Kit” sounds like “Sit”)
- Consider your dog’s color, size, and temperament
- Try the name out loud—does it feel natural?
A great name is one that makes you smile every time you call it.

❓ FAQs About Pitbull Dog Names
What are the best names for a Pitbull dog?
The best names reflect personality—popular choices include Rocky, Luna, Diesel, and Bella.
Should Pitbull names be short or long?
Short names (1–2 syllables) are ideal because they are easier for dogs to recognize and respond to.
Can I rename an adopted Pitbull?
Yes! Dogs can adapt quickly to a new name with consistent training and repetition.
Do Pitbulls respond better to certain sounds?
Yes, names ending in vowel sounds (like “Bella” or “Milo”) are easier for dogs to hear and learn.
How do I test if a name is right?
Say it out loud multiple times. If it feels natural and your dog responds, it’s a great choice!
